Why Bifold Doors Are So Popular

Space Efficiency with Style

Unlike traditional hinged doors that swing open and take up room, bifold doors fold neatly to the side, offering a clean and clutter-free opening. This makes them ideal for smaller areas like apartments, compact rooms, or anywhere where maximizing space is a priority.

But practicality isn’t their only strength. Bifold doors look stunning too. Their sleek lines and minimalist design bring a sense of modernity to any setting, from industrial lofts to rustic farmhouses.

Natural Light and Open Feel

One of the most sought-after features in today’s interior design is the use of natural light. Bifold doors, especially those with large glass panels, allow sunlight to flood into a room, instantly making it feel larger, warmer, and more welcoming.

When fully opened, they create a seamless flow between indoor and outdoor spaces — perfect for homes with gardens, terraces, or balconies. The transition feels effortless, making them a favourite for homeowners who love to entertain or simply enjoy scenic views without stepping outside.

Material Choices That Make a Difference

Aluminum

Lightweight, durable, and weather-resistant, aluminum bifold doors are ideal for both interiors and exteriors. Their slim profiles allow for larger glass panels and unobstructed views.

Wood

For those who value character and warmth, wooden bifold doors are hard to beat. They add a natural, grounded feel to spaces and can be easily painted or stained to match your interior style.

uPVC

A more budget-friendly option, uPVC bifold doors come in a variety of colours and finishes. While they might not have the same premium feel as aluminum or timber, they’re practical and low-maintenance.

Installation Tips for Maximum Impact

Let the Experts Handle It

No matter how good the door looks, poor installation can ruin everything. Professional installers ensure correct alignment, smooth operation, and long-term durability.

Consider the Opening Direction

Think about how the doors will fold and in which direction they’ll stack. This impacts space usage and convenience, especially in smaller rooms.

Maintenance and Cleaning

Most bifold doors are low-maintenance, but it’s wise to clean the tracks and check for alignment regularly to ensure smooth operation. Use non-abrasive cleaning products, especially for glass surfaces.

FAQs About Bifold Doors

Are bifold doors only suitable for large homes?

Not at all. Bifold doors come in various sizes and can be custom-fit to suit compact apartments, studios, and even wardrobes.

Can bifold doors be used indoors only?

They are ideal for both interior and exterior use. Interior bifold doors are great for room divisions, while exterior ones create seamless garden or balcony access.

Are bifold doors energy efficient?

Yes, especially those with double-glazed glass and thermal break technology. They help maintain indoor temperatures and reduce energy bills.

Do bifold doors require regular maintenance?

Basic cleaning of tracks and glass is usually enough. Occasional checks for alignment and lubrication will keep them operating smoothly.
